Full job description
You will be 18 months (or less) from running your own hotel and keen to join a brand that will give you the opportunity to shine. Five of our current General Managers have been promoted from the Deputy General Manager position.
In this role you’re a real organizer, who loves leading and motivating your team. You will be driving the brand strategy in all elements of the business and helping set Malmaison apart from the competition as a preferred employer and destination to stay, eat and drink.
As Deputy General Manager in Manchester you will know the local market and understand how to maximise revenue within the business by looking at the bigger picture, managing the detail through your department managers and team will be second nature and leading from the front to set the example is something you are no stranger to. You will need a good understanding of Health & Safety and be able to communicate effectively. They say the devil is in the detail and here at Malmaison it definitely is.
Ideally you will have had previous experience in managing large teams and you will have a sound knowledge of food and drink in a similar sized property however this isn’t a deal breaker.

Our Sustainability Goals:
- 100% of our electricity is generated using renewable energy with most of it coming from Wind Farms around the UK
- We recycle a minimum of 70% of the waste from our hotels. This target is achieved by everyone I the hotel focusing on the waste we produce and is championed by our Sustainability Council who work on project year round
- We have moved to a chemical free cleaning system in our bedrooms and public areas and an enzyme based eco-friendly system for our kitchens.
- Volunteer to work for sustainable charities 2 days per year on full pay instead of your normal workplace
